Has anyone had experience of 2e? Twice exceptional?

We feel our son is pointing to this; advanced reading age, strong in maths, excellent memory, musical abilities.. And yet has signs of inattentive ADHD, slow processing and social/emotional masking.. fatigue after school.

We are starting to think of secondary schools and what may suit best? State or private? We would love his strengths catered to. We would look in London, Sussex or Kent.

Any advice or tips on what to look for! We do not yet have an EHCP but are looking into starting the process with help of an Ed Psyc.

You could look at Thames Christian, St James’, Hampton Court, Frensham Heights. None of them are the most academic schools around, but they have a fair few DC with SEN.

I would request an EHCNA ASAP. You don’t need an EP assessment before requesting an EHCNA.
